Sažetak
The focus of this paper is the prevalence of foreign languages in the higher education curricula in Croatia as well as the analysis of studies published in Croatian scientific journals on the relationship between foreign languages and the study of tourism and hospitality industry curriculum. Taking into consideration that the turism is crucial for the development of Croatia, the foreign languages are supposed to be an important part of the education curricula. The study analyses Croatian scientific discourse on the topic of prevelence of the importance of foreign languages learning in correlation with the study of tourism and hospitality industry curricul. The second part of the study shows the prevalence of foreign languages in the curricula of the study of tourism and hospitality industry in Croatia. The preliminary results show the presence of foreign languages within the curricula, but also their inadequate presence in the Croatian academic publications.
